We've got 3D-Printing on the Brain! - Special Episode
Chantal MacLean, a Translational and Molecular Medicine student at the University of Ottawa, interviews Dr. Stephanie Willerth. Dr. Willerth is a Full Professor and Canada Research Chair in Biomedical Engineering at the University of Victoria. She also currently serves as the Acting Director of the Centre for Biomedical Research at the University of Victoria. In this episode, Dr. Willerth discusses her research using 3D bioprinting to print brain tissue and what inspired her to enter this exciting research field.
